1. A method for determining the presence of a target nucleic acid molecule in a sample, the method comprising:

  • a) suspending the sample in a collection medium comprising an anionic detergent and a non-ionic detergent;

    b) denaturing the target nucleic acid molecule in the sample;

    c) forming a double-stranded nucleic acid hybrid by contacting at least one polynucleotide probe with the target nucleic acid molecule;

    d) forming a double-stranded nucleic acid hybrid-support complex by capturing the double-stranded nucleic acid hybrid on a magnetic bead comprising a first antibody;

    e) forming a double-stranded nucleic acid hybrid-support-second antibody complex by contacting the double-stranded nucleic acid hybrid-support complex with a second antibody, wherein the second antibody is labeled with a detectable marker;

    f) washing the double-stranded nucleic acid hybrid-support-second antibody complex with a wash buffer; and

    g) detecting the marker on the second antibody wherein the detecting indicates the presence of the target nucleic acid molecule,wherein the collection medium is present at least from step a) to step d).
